Hair fall & Skin allergy
Hello Doctor, I want to discuss 2 problems here. One, I have severe hair fall these days. Previously I was living in Chennai and for the past 3 and half yrs in Bangalore. When I was in Chennai i had hair fall but after coming to Bangalore the amount of hair fall has increased to which my hair is becoming thinner day by day. I wash my hair twice a week to keep it dirt free. Can please suggest any way to regain my hair strength. Second, since childhood I m very allergic to mosquitoes due to which if have scars all over my hands and legs and upper back. In sleep I scratch it also due to which i feel irritation when i get up in the morning. I try to keep myself away from mosquitoes but unfortunately I m not able to do that. I apply odomos and keep all-out and do what not. Due to this my skin looks dirty. I kindly request you to suggest a solution to which so that i can look better. Thanks in advance. :)

Thanks for the query. FPB is an increasing problem in today's society. Hair care is a daily ritual shaped by age, gender and internal health. The treatment typically consists of topical lotion (Minoxidil). Based on the cause of hair loss, certain specific medications can also be started. It also depends on the age of the patient and if planning f or pregnancy or not. Various issues need to be decided before initiating the treatment. The dosage and duration is decided by your dermatologist. You need to be patient with the treatment protocol as it takes months to see initial improvement. Certain Dermatologists supplement biotin, hair serum and advice procedures like PRP therapy which may accelerate the rate of hair growth. PRP needs multiple sessions roughly at 6 weeks intervals. PRP therapy is increasingly being accepted by dermatologists all over the world. Apart from active pharmaceutical medicines, a healthy diet and lifestyle is mandatory to achieve results. About your skin, use a good moisturiser and try to be in mosquito nets at sleep time

Hi! Thanks for your query. 1. Losing your hair can do serious damage to your self-esteem. But luckily, there are plenty of options to help you fight it. Hair loss is very common these days because of increased stress,nutritional deficiencies, lack of exercise and increase intake of junk food. Other causes of hair fall could be genetic, hormonal imbalances, under-active thyroid gland, and insufficient blood circulation in the scalp. There are many treatment options for hair loss including medications, home remedies. There are various over the counter medications available for preventing hair loss, but you need the ones most suitable to your hair type to get effective results.  Home remedies would include oiling your hair more often, include Amla/Indian gooseberry in your diet to promote new hair growth, apple cider vinegar can be effective to control hair fall. 2. You seem to have a sensitive skin as well. Try to keep your skin moisturized and supple. Apply a heavy moisturizer at night. Wear full sleeves clothes at night. Procedures like spot laser can take care of old marks.
